New WLCCA version 4.3.7 is available

Fixes

  • Exception while Parsing on clean air devices due to missing space
  • Exception if power level=0
  • Incorect handling of options for site summary (more than one WLC loaded)
  • Last radio mac conversion to zero for AP-COS 
  • Corrections on RF Stats display

New Features

  • Support for 82MR5, 83MR1
  • New notification if the controller has low memory condition (requires WLC on 8.2MR5/8.3MR1). 
  • General fixes on RF summary per controller
